Here are the Brady seasons records in descending order:

16-0 -- 2007
14-2 -- 2003
14-2 -- 2004
14-2 --2010
14-2 -- 2017
13-3 -- 2011
13-3 -- 2018
12-4 -- 2006
12-4 -- 2012
12-4 -- 2013
12-4 -- 2014
12-4 -- 2015
11-3 -- 2001 *Bledsoe started 0-2
10-6 -- 2005
10-6 -- 2009
9-7 -- 2002
